Transaction 61b38e206870d1146b9192519bd97c1d677d8d702ba04acdb82dcc83a54ee189

135 Input
2 Outputs
  • 61b38e206870d1146b9192519bd97c1d677d8d702ba04acdb82dcc83a54ee189:0
  • value  1010915
    address  35AYQjdSBjoc7i3rmJmY73v3zz3T85kBSo
  • 61b38e206870d1146b9192519bd97c1d677d8d702ba04acdb82dcc83a54ee189:1
  • value  2174519419
    address  3DCQiNx13jdjmyur6SKzKEybMFhpTeL7jn